1891 Pirates. The lineup had:
Jake Beckley, Ned Hanlon, Louis Bierbauer, Pete Browning, Connie Mack, Doggie Miller and some other good players, plus Pud Galvin, Mark Baldwin, Harry Staley all pitching. Finished 55-80 http://pittsburghpirateshistory.word...burgh-pirates/
